How safe is Coberley?
Coberley has a low crime rate for a South West village, with around 6 recorded crimes per 1,000 people a year. This is 92% below the national average, and 90% below the Gloucestershire average. These figures are based on 9 of 12 months of police data. The rate is adjusted for visitor and workday population. The comparison is stabilised for a small population. What are the demographics of Coberley?
The majority of residents in Coberley identify as White (British) (89%). Most residents were born in the United Kingdom (88%). The most common religion is Christian (56%).
